COVER IMAGE: The Nobel Prize Medal was designed by Erik Lindberg and is manufactured in recycled gold by Svenska Medalj in Eskilstuna. The medals are cast in 18 carat gold and plated with 24 carat gold. In Stockholm, Wishing you an enjoyable reading! today, when even obvious facts are the number of events expanded in LARS HEIKENSTEN being denied. preparation for a more extensive array EXECUTIVE DIRECTOR 1 Table of Contents 1 To the Greatest Benefit to Mankind 4 The 2017 Nobel Laureates 8 Vital Learning 10 The Future of Truth 12 Ban the Bomb 14 The Art of Portraying a Nobel Laureate 16 Unique Objects and Stories 20 Alfred Nobel 24 Growing Operations 26 The Institutions that Select Nobel Laureates 28 The Nobel Foundation 30 Nobel Media AB 32 Nobel Museum AB 34 Nobel Center 36 Nobel Peace Center Foundation 38 Nobel Peace Prize – Research & Information AS 40 Highlights in December 2 ICAN – the International Campaign to Abolish Nuclear Weapons – was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 2017. Only a few hours after the announcement, the exhibition at the Nobel Peace Center in Oslo was updated, and ICAN took place among the other Peace Laureates awarded the prize since 1901. PHOTO: PI FRISK 3 The organisation ICAN was represented by Setsuko Thurlow, a survivor of the atomic bombing of Hiroshima and Executive Director Beatrice Fihn. They received the Nobel Prize Medal and diploma from Berit Reiss-Andersen at the Oslo City Hall on December 10, 2017. 4 The 2017 Nobel Laureates THE NOBEL PRIZE IN THE NOBEL PRIZE IN PHYSICS 2017 CHEMISTRY 2017 WAS AWARDED TO WAS AWARDED TO Rainer Weiss, Barry C.
